Chimeric Antigen Receptor (CAR) T Cells With a Chlorotoxin Tumor-Targeting Domain for the Treatment of MMP2+ Recurrent or Progressive Glioblastoma
United States19 participantsStarted 2020-02-26
Plain-language summary
This phase I trial studies the side effects and best dose of chimeric antigen receptor (CAR) T cells with a chlorotoxin tumor-targeting domain in treating patients with MPP2+ glioblastoma that has come back (recurrent) or that is growing, spreading, or getting worse (progressive). Inclusion Criteria:
* Documented informed consent of the participant and/or legally authorized representative. Assent, when appropriate, will be obtained per institutional guidelines. Note: For research participants who do not speak English, a short form consent may be used with a COH certified interpreter/translator to proceed with screening and leukapheresis, while the request for a translated main consent is processed. However, the research participant is allowed to proceed with surgery/rickham placement and CAR T cell infusion only after the translated main consent form is signed.
* Agreement to allow the use of archival tissue from diagnostic tumor biopsies. If unavailable, exceptions may be granted with study principal investigator (PI) approval
* Karnofsky performance status (KPS) \>= 60%
* Eastern Cooperative Oncology Group (ECOG) =\< 2
* Life expectancy \>= 4 weeks
* Participant has a prior histologically-confirmed diagnosis of a grade IV glioblastoma, or has a prior histologically-confirmed diagnosis of a grade II or III malignant brain tumors and now has radiographic progression consistent with a grade IV glioblastoma
* Relapsed disease: radiographic evidence of recurrence/progression of measurable disease after standard therapy, and \>= 12 weeks after completion of front-line radiation therapy
* City of Hope (COH) Clinical Pathology confirms matrix metalloproteinase (MMP)2+ tumor expression by immunohistochemistry (\>= 20% moderate/high MMP2 \[2+/3+\])
